Class 4 WW2 Baking

February 8, 2024Admin

On Thursday 8th February, Class 4 did some WW2 baking with Mrs Coles and they made carrot cookies using: margarine, self raising flour, carrots, sugar, vanilla essence.  They tasted delicious and all the children had a great morning baking. Here are the photos.
